�55357;�56481; The goal of TAAILS is to rethink our approaches and systems of aging using Strategic Doing to test ideas by “doing the doable” through small experiments. Why?
· By 2030, one in five Americas will be over the age of 65.
· That is more than a two-fold increase in 30 years.
Rethinking how we actively age, how communities support it, and sharing best practices will is essential.
